British pop invasion : how British music conquered the world in the 1960s

2014
Books, Manuscripts
The British Pop Invasion is a photographic record of that era using hundreds of rare Daily Mirror images, many of them unpublished. This book is a must for baby boomers of the period, music lovers of any age and pop culture historians.
